Recipes: 0 Rep Power: 55 | To understand the answer to your question, you have to understand the most basic fundamental rule of how your body works to store or lose fat. When you take in more calories than you burn daily, you have the potential to gain weight, either by building muscle, or by storing fat. When you take in fewer calories than you burn daily, your body is forced to fuel it's energy needs by either burning stored fat or by burning muscle. When you are taking in more calories than you are burning, your body does one of three things with those calories: 1) It puts the extra calories to use toward building muscle or toward recovery and repair of your body tissue, or other essential bodily functions 2) The extra calories are stored for future energy needs in the form of fat 3) The extra calories do not become fully digested and simply pass through the body. When you take in less calories than you are burning daily, one of two basic things happen: 1) Your body burns your stored fat to get the energy it needs, since not enough energy is coming from dietary sources. 2) Your body burns your muscle tissue to get the energy it needs, since not enough energy is coming from dietary sources. So, to answer your question, If you are taking in more calories than your body is burning each day, it will have no need to dip into it's fat reserves for energy... so you will not burn fat. In order to force your body to burn fat.... your calories burned each day must be greater than your dietary intake of calories. This is "Cutting". The key to determining whether your body burns fat for energy, or burns muscle for energy has to do with how great a caloric deficit you put your body under, and the timing and macronutrient content of the food that you are eating. To make sure you are burning more fat, and less ( if any ) muscle, go with as low a caloric deficit as possible that still allows you to lose weight according to your goals. To spare muscle, design a plan that calls for no more than 1-2 pounds lost per week. Also, keep your meals coming in on a regular basis, at least every 2-3 hours. This keeps your metabolism stimulated, and keeps a regular influx of the protein, carbs, fat and calories that your body needs for it's essential processes. Finally, to make sure that you hold on to your muscle, be sure to include weight training as part of your training plan. If you are regularly using your muscles, your body knows it needs them and will look to fat instead of muscle to fuel it's energy needs. Hopefully this explains things for you.
